It's been my experience that you get thrown more strikes when your contact and those other less specific attributes are really low (patience/discipline/whatever)... When those are low, pitchers apparently don't think you'll do very well with balls over the plate, so they bring it. Which means, it's REALLY hard to take walks early in your career. They seem to be painting the black all the time. The truth is, they're grooving balls to a weak hitter, and missing by a few inches (which is the black). You'll stike out looking if you're not aggressive early in your career. Once you have some attributes up, the pitchers will be afraid to pitch you down the middle, and you'll be able to draw more walks.
